Batista Reveals His Favorite WWE Match

During a recent edition of “The Ross Report” podcast, former World Heavyweight Champion Batista revealed his favorite match in WWE. Below is his discussion with Jim Ross:

JR: Is that your favorite big match (vs. The Undertaker from WrestleMania 23) on your resume from WWE?

Batista: My favorite match is the Hell in a Cell I had with Hunter actually. It probably wasn’t nearly as good as the one I had with Taker. It definitely wasn’t as significant or as big.

But the reason I love this match is because I think up until the very last second we beat the hell out of each other and that was the good old days when we were bleeding everywhere. We were going to war with each other. And we started off this match with people chanting “Boring…Boring”.

At the end of the match we just had everybody just sucked in. And in this match, you literally didn’t know what the outcome was going to be until the very last second which is hard to get done. And I felt really accomplished coming out of that match.

Actually probably my favorite televised match, my favorite big match, the favorite match of my career was actually a house show match I had in Mexico with Rey.

JR: Really? Were you the big heel?

Batista: I was and I begged and pleaded because we weren’t on the card and I knew I was a short-termer in the company. I was heel at the time and…you know…working Rey as a heel in Mexico is just anybody’s dream come true.

And I begged and pleaded to give me this match and I finally got it and we gave them a pay-per-view match man and when I came back from the match everybody was….I mean people were applauding.

I’m talking about the boys, they were applauding us like we turned a house show into a pay-per-view and we just gave them everything. I mean everything. All the bells and whistles.

Update On Women’s Royal Rumble Match Taking Place In 2018

Dave Meltzer of the Wrestling Observer recently noted how a Women’s Royal Rumble match in 2018 is not being planned. However, The Sun UK doesn’t think so.

After 5 new female NXT wrestlers debuted on the WWE main roster last week, The Sun UK is reporting that WWE will indeed be doing the first ever Women’s Royal Rumble match next year:

“But now the event is set to be confirmed, although the details remain scarce and it is possible it may not have entrants as in the male equivalent. A number of women on the roster have already spoken on the possibility of a women’s Rumble.”

As of right now, there are 21 female wrestlers on the WWE main roster.
